I have a pair of 23x7x10 fronts with about an hour of riding on them that I'd sell for $90 + shipping if anybody wants them. They created a "wandering" feeling on our 400EX, like it just wouldn't go straight and was real "darty."
We replaced them with the same size Holeshot XTC and she likes them alot more. Especially after I shaved off the side knobs so they quit throwing sand straight up under the chin while turning! |
